How to Locate an Inmate

To locate an inmate at the Windham County Jail, you can visit the official State of Connecticut Department of Correction website and use their inmate search function, entering relevant details such as the inmate’s name or unique identifier.

How to Send Money

Friends and family can send money to inmates through approved electronic funds transfer services. While specific services accepted may vary, a commonly used service is JPay. You can make transactions online by visiting the JPay website.

Frequently Asked Questions

Q: How do I send a letter to an inmate?

A: To send a letter to an inmate, use the following address format: Inmate Name, ID Number, Windham County Jail, 155 Church St., Putnam, CT 06260, USA. Always check the facility’s mail policy before sending.

Q: Can I leave a message for an inmate?

A: No, messages cannot directly be left for inmates. You must wait for the inmate to contact you via phone call.
